Mecca Masjid

Mecca Masjid is regarded as one of the seven wonders of the Hyderabad. Muhammad Quli Qutlub Shah commissioned this biggest Masjid and the conquerer Aurangazeb had been completed this Masjid. Construction began in 1694 and was taken about 77 years to be completed and the construction is supervised by Mir Faizullah Baig and Rangaiah Chowdary. Mecca Masjid is the oldest one Masjid in the Hyderabad. The Mecca Masjid is located in the Southern sector of the Hyderabad city. In 1996, it was stated as a protected monument.

The main hall of the Mecca Masjid has a height of 75 feet, width of 220 feet and length is of 180 feet. In this Masjid there is a pond flanked by slab seats. It is believed that if a person sits on one of the pond’s seats then he will surely once return to Hyderabad. In 1995, this building has given a chemical wash because the structure of this building is cracked because of lack of maintenance. In August 2001, in order to put a stop on the further damage of the Mecca Masjid, Charminar (a traffic zone), is made by the Andhra Pradesh government. On May 18, 2007 there was a bomb explosion take place at the Mecca Masjid and about 16 people were killed and 56 were seriously injure.
